# Extracts the contents from the events and transform them into a list of
# (author, simplified_content) tuples.
def simplify_events(events: list[Event]) -> list[(str, types.Part)]:
return [(event.author, simplify_content(event.content)) for event in events]
# Simplifies the contents into a list of (author, simplified_content) tuples.
def simplify_contents(contents: list[types.Content]) -> list[(str, types.Part)]:
return [(content.role, simplify_content(content)) for content in contents]
# Simplifies the content so it's easier to assert.
# - If there is only one part, return part
# - If the only part is pure text, return stripped_text
# - If there are multiple parts, return parts
# - remove function_call_id if it exists
def simplify_content(
content: types.Content,
) -> Union[str, types.Part, list[types.Part]]:
for part in content.parts:
if part.function_call and part.function_call.id:
part.function_call.id = None
if part.function_response and part.function_response.id:
part.function_response.id = None
if len(content.parts) == 1:
if content.parts[0].text:
return content.parts[0].text.strip()
else:
return content.parts[0]
return content.parts
def get_user_content(message: types.ContentUnion) -> types.Content:
return message if isinstance(message, types.Content) else UserContent(message)

class MockModel(BaseLlm):
model: str = 'mock'
requests: list[LlmRequest] = []
responses: list[LlmResponse]
response_index: int = -1
@classmethod
def create(
cls,
responses: Union[
list[types.Part], list[LlmResponse], list[str], list[list[types.Part]]
],
):
if not responses:
return cls(responses=[])
elif isinstance(responses[0], LlmResponse):
# responses is list[LlmResponse]
return cls(responses=responses)
else:
responses = [
LlmResponse(content=ModelContent(item))
if isinstance(item, list) and isinstance(item[0], types.Part)
# responses is list[list[Part]]
else LlmResponse(
content=ModelContent(
# responses is list[str] or list[Part]
[Part(text=item) if isinstance(item, str) else item]
)
)
for item in responses
if item
]
return cls(responses=responses)
@staticmethod
def supported_models() -> list[str]:
return ['mock']
def generate_content(
self, llm_request: LlmRequest, stream: bool = False
) -> Generator[LlmResponse, None, None]:
# Increasement of the index has to happen before the yield.
self.response_index += 1
self.requests.append(llm_request)
# yield LlmResponse(content=self.responses[self.response_index])
yield self.responses[self.response_index]
@override
async def generate_content_async(
self, llm_request: LlmRequest, stream: bool = False
) -> AsyncGenerator[LlmResponse, None]:
# Increasement of the index has to happen before the yield.
self.response_index += 1
self.requests.append(llm_request)
yield self.responses[self.response_index]
@contextlib.asynccontextmanager
async def connect(self, llm_request: LlmRequest) -> BaseLlmConnection:
"""Creates a live connection to the LLM."""
yield MockLlmConnection(self.responses)
class MockLlmConnection(BaseLlmConnection):
def __init__(self, llm_responses: list[LlmResponse]):
self.llm_responses = llm_responses
async def send_history(self, history: list[types.Content]):
pass
async def send_content(self, content: types.Content):
pass
async def send(self, data):
pass
async def send_realtime(self, blob: types.Blob):
pass
async def receive(self) -> AsyncGenerator[LlmResponse, None]:
"""Yield each of the pre-defined LlmResponses."""
for response in self.llm_responses:
yield response
async def close(self):
pass
